The
purpose of the Industrial Molding Program to train technical staff for mold
industry. The technical staff is knowledgeable about technical drawing,
machining, mold manufacturing. They can design molds with computer aided mold
design programmes. They know principles of operation of the basic machinery and
equipment like CNC machines, various presses.

Graduate
students of this program may apply to study in undergraduate programs. (Faculty of Technology or Faculty of Engineering)
In order to be able to graduate from the Industrial Moulding Program, the total number of national credits required to be completed by the students is a total of 92, including 22 elective courses. The amount of ECTS credits is determined as 120 for each semester. The education period of the Industrial Moulding Program is 2 years long.
The student who has successfully completed all the courses listed in the curriculum and has completed all the activities listed in this Regulation and other applicable legislation. In addition to them, the graduate student must have successfully completed 30 days of internship. The internship has not been credited with the program as it is a prerequisite for graduation. AGNOs must be at least 2.00 level and all other studies must be completed.
